Vanessa Serret is a scholar working on Accounting, Economics and Econometrics and Strategy and Management. According to data from OpenAlex, Vanessa Serret has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 312 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Accounting, 7 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 5 papers in Strategy and Management. Recurrent topics in Vanessa Serret’s work include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(7 papers), Corporate Finance and Governance (6 papers) and Market Dynamics and Volatility (6 papers). Vanessa Serret is often cited by papers focused on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(7 papers), Corporate Finance and Governance (6 papers) and Market Dynamics and Volatility (6 papers). Vanessa Serret collaborates with scholars based in France, Canada and Algeria. Vanessa Serret's co-authors include Sylvie Berthelot, Michel Coulmont, Sami Ben Jabeur, Kamel Si Mohammed, Salma Mefteh‐Wali, Christian Urom, Uğur Korkut Pata, Haitham Nobanee, Mustafa Tevfik Kartal and Sylvie St‐Onge and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Environmental Management, Resources Policy and Corporate Social Responsibility and Environmental Management.
